VASRD 5102 · Musculoskeletal System
You have a decent prosthetic fit but still deal with pain or limitations.
60%: single veteran, no dependents
$1,435.02
$17,220.24/year · tax-free · effective December 1, 2025
Functional stump allowing for good prosthetic use but still causes discomfort and motion limits.
Monthly compensation amounts for Amputation of Thigh at Middle or Lower Third rated at 60%. Dependent additions apply at 30% and above.
| Single (no dependents) | $1,435.02 |
| With spouse | $1,566.02 |
| With spouse + 1 child | $1,663.02 |
| With spouse + 2 children | $1,728.02 |
| Single + 1 child (no spouse) | $1,523.02 |
